If the sum of the coefficients of all even powers of x in the product (1 + x + x2 + ... + x2n) (1 - x + x2 - x3 + ... + x2n) is 61, then n is equal to _________.

Let (1 + x + x2 +…+ x2n) (1 - x + x2 - x3 +…+x2n

= a0 + a1x + a2x2 + a3x3 + a4x4 +…+a4nx4n

So, a0 + a1 + a2 +…+ a4n = 2n + 1 …(1)

a0 - a1 + a2 - a3…+ a4n = 2n + 1 …(2)

⇒ a0 + a2 + a4 +…+a4n = 2n + 1

⇒ 2n + 1 = 61 ⇒ n = 30
